Output 875886bb11a2dd26d3278ea23daef96e6112d7001958a77aa914783e4e9e9b3c:20

value
970349000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b9e6733a2a0012c7ae9ef1b9b4f4ebb947a530 OP_EQUALVERIFY OP_CHECKSIG
address
1ECF1CM5FyDmDcGsWoyofns5H5ab5NkWEZ
transaction
875886bb11a2dd26d3278ea23daef96e6112d7001958a77aa914783e4e9e9b3c
spent
true